Doree de Tournai

Dessert apple

Malus domestica Borkh.

Raised by Joseph de Gaest de Braffe at Tournai, Belgium in 1817. Fruits have firm, crisp flesh with a sweet, subacid rich aromatic flavour.

Synonyms:
Doree de Tournay, Gold Apfel von Tournay, la Dorade
